Each Tuesday, we share what's interesting us in the food blogosphere.

All I really need to write to get your attention is that the BBQ Jew, a local food blog, now has a merchandise page. Who doesn't want a t-shirt that says: "Devout from Tail to Snout: BBQ Jew."

Here is a link to the BBQ Jew merchandise page

If you haven't noticed, you soon will realize that I'm a big fan of frugal/personal finance blogs. This blog, Suddenly Frugal, is a new one for me but I liked this recent post about the money you can save by packing your children's school lunches.

About the blogger

Andrea Weigl has been the food writer at The News & Observer since the summer of 2007. She has won a handful of awards from the Association of Food Journalists and the Society for Features Journalism. Her profile of chef Ashley Christensen titled "A Force of Nature" will be published in the sixth edition of "Cornbread Nation: The Best of Southern Food Writing." She is serving a three-year term on the James Beard Foundation book awards committee. Follow her on Twitter at @andreaweigl.
